Ignore:
Timestamp:
20/08/08 14:03:20 (11 years ago)
Author:
cbyrom
Message:

General refactoring and updating of code, including:

Removal of refC14nKw and singnedInfoC14nKw keywords in wsssecurity session manager config
(the refC14nInclNS and signedInfoC14nInclNS keywords are sufficient);
Creation of new DOM signature handler class, dom.py, based on the wsSecurity
class;
Abstraction of common code between dom.py and etree.py into new parent
class, BaseSignatureHandler?.py.
Fixing and extending use of properties in the SignatureHandler? code.
Fixing a few bugs with the original SignatureHandler? code.
Updating of test cases to new code/code structure.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• TI12-security/trunk/python/ndg.security.server/ndg/security/server/SessionMgr/__init__.py

    r4119 r4129  
    940940            # 
    941941            wssSignatureHandlerKw = { 
    942             'refC14nKw': {'unsuppressedPrefixes':  
    943                           self.__prop.get('wssRefInclNS', [])}, 
    944             'signedInfoC14nKw':{'unsuppressedPrefixes': 
    945                                 self.__prop.get('wssSignedInfoInclNS', [])}} 
     942            'refC14nInclNS': self.__prop.get('wssRefInclNS', []), 
     943            'signedInfoC14nInclNS': self.__prop.get('wssSignedInfoInclNS', [])} 
    946944 
    947945            try:    
Note: See TracChangeset for help on using the changeset viewer.